- A recent Forsyth County traffic arrest has led to a statewide drug bust. The investigative leads led members of the drug task force to a narcotics stash house in Buckhead, among other locations. Additionally, a female suspect in Buckhead was charged with trafficking fentanyl. (Appen Media)

- The Buckhead Heritage Society shared a clip of Henry L. Howell, whose family once owned about 4,000 acres of property in the area, discussing the victory garden at his parentsβ home. (Buckhead Heritage Society via Facebook)
- Carl E. Sanders Family YMCA at Buckhead shared a video showing how the YMCA of Metro Atlanta is tackling summer learning loss, a result of the pandemic. The YMCA has focused on creating transformational experiences that contribute to children's social-emotional growth and development. (Carl E. Sanders Family YMCA at Buckhead via Facebook)
